A man has been arrested and charged after he allegedly threatened staff with a hammer while attempting to rob an Athol Park IGA.

Police say they were called to the IGA on The Avenue just after 2.30pm on Monday after reports of a robbery.

Police also allege the man threatened staff with a hammer before taking off on his bicycle.

CCTV footage obtained by 9News shows the man being confronted by a staff member before allegedly presenting a hammer from a pocket in his pants.

9News reported the man was spotted taking a few items and refused to handover his backpack to staff when questioned.

It was also reported that the man then swung the hammer at the shop owner’s face.

No-one was injured in the incident.

The 28-year-old man from Pennington was located by police a short time later and arrested.

He was charged with theft and aggravated assault and was bailed to appear in court at a later date.
